Stop 1: Baheli Beef Hotpot
This hotpot spot is basically a food temple for Chaoshan locals. π₯©π₯
The moment you walk in, the aroma hits you.
I ordered like I was prepping for the imperial exams:
Tender beef, shrimp, veggies, tofu...
This was Qing dynasty-level banquet behavior. π§βπππ«
I cooked and live streamed at the same time. π±π₯
That first bite of beef? Soul ascension.

Next, I rented an electric scooter.
Camera up recording the streetsβI was the main character. π§π΅
Destination: Shantou Old Town
β’ Colonial-era arcades like forgotten film rolls π½οΈ
β’ Aunties folding history into rice rolls at alleyway stalls
β’ Menus all QR codes, old dudes stared at me like I was an alien
But I didnβt panicβ
I was the alien. Mandarin-speaking, sun-soaked foreigner. πΈππ«
